Comment #1 on issue 3220 by [email protected]: partcombineChords affects preceding note and gives wrong output
http://code.google.com/p/lilypond/issues/detail?id=3220

Moving \partcombineChords from the soprano to the alto part fixes the output. It looks like the chords force event is processed too early if it occurs in the first voice, so it affects the second voice earlier than it should. The second c'16 is forced to be stem-up, which breaks the beam that would start at the first c'16.

By the way, if chord-threshold in part-combiner.scm were configurable, it would have made \partcombineChords unneeded for my purposes.
